An unmodernised three bedroom apartment with lift access and a large terrace, situated on the fifth floor of a handsome Grade II listed white stucco fronted Victorian building on a prime garden square in South Kensington SW7.
Upon entering the apartment, a central hallway, including a guest cloakroom, leads to a spacious dining room, perfect for hosting and entertaining guests. Adjacent to the dining room is a kitchen, including integrated appliances.
At the front of the property, the impressive south-facing reception room is characterised by a period fireplace and wide sash windows, which fill the space with natural light.
The principal bedroom is discreetly positioned toward the rear and is generously proportioned, benefiting from an en suite and a dressing room, providing ample storage. The remaining two bedrooms offer versatility, ideal for guest accommodation or home office use. A second bathroom is conveniently located just off the hallway.
The apartment further benefits from an impressive paved terrace, perfect for al fresco dining and entertaining.
One of the most highly regarded addresses in South Kensington, the property is quietly positioned in a prime area of Queen's Gate Gardens, a cosmopolitan area close to Gloucester Road and Kensington High Street, which offers plenty of shops, restaurants and cafes. Kensington Gardens and Hyde Park are a short walk away. The nearest underground station is Gloucester Road (District, Circle and Piccadilly lines). Motorists will benefit from rapid routes to the West and Heathrow Airport via M4.
